Accessing Your Apple ID Settings

The journey to remove credit card from iPhone begins not in the Wallet app, but within your Apple ID profile. Apple treats payment information as a core account detail rather than just a device-specific setting. You must navigate to the central hub where your subscriptions, iCloud data, and payment methods are managed to initiate the removal process.

Launching the Configuration Screen

To start, open the Settings app on your home screen. Tap on your name at the top of the menu, which brings you to your Apple ID overview. From here, you will select the option for "Payments & Shipping," which is usually located near the top of the list. This action authenticates your identity and prepares the system for payment management.

Managing Active Payment Methods

Once inside the Payments section, you will see a list of active financial instruments linked to your account. This is where the actual removal occurs, and it is important to distinguish between the card used for the App Store and the card stored in Wallet for contactless payments. The interface is designed to make the targeted card easy to identify.

Editing and Deletion Process

To remove credit card from iPhone, locate the card entry you wish to delete. Tap on the card number or the "Edit" button next to the list. A red delete option will appear, usually accompanied by a warning message. Confirming this action immediately severs the link between that specific card number and your Apple ID, preventing future automatic charges.

The Role of the Wallet App

While removing the card from Payments settings cuts off the billing relationship, you should also clean up the Wallet app for complete hygiene. The Wallet stores a separate tokenized version of the card for Apple Pay. If you leave this untouched, the card icon will remain on your phone, even though it is no longer active for purchases.

Physical Deletion from Wallet

Navigate to the Wallet app on your home screen. Open the specific card you wish to discard. Scroll to the bottom of the card details screen and tap "Remove Card." You might be prompted to verify your identity with a passcode or Face ID. This step ensures that the digital representation of the card is wiped from the device’s secure element.
